数据库程序员叫什么

worktile 其他 9

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库程序员通常被称为"数据库开发工程师"或"数据库管理员"。这些专业人员负责设计、开发和管理数据库系统,确保数据的安全性、完整性和可靠性。以下是数据库程序员的五个主要职责和工作内容:

    1. 数据库设计和开发:数据库程序员负责设计和开发数据库系统,包括确定数据模型、创建表结构、定义数据字段和关系等。他们使用数据库管理系统(如MySQL、Oracle、SQL Server等)编写和优化SQL查询,以实现高效的数据访问和操作。

    2. 数据库性能优化:数据库程序员通过调整数据库配置、优化查询语句和索引设计等方式来提高数据库系统的性能。他们监视数据库的运行状态,识别潜在的性能瓶颈,并采取相应的措施来提高系统的响应速度和吞吐量。

    3. 数据库安全和备份:数据库程序员负责确保数据库系统的安全性和可靠性。他们设置访问权限和安全策略,以保护敏感数据免受未经授权的访问和恶意攻击。此外,他们还负责定期备份数据库,并制定灾难恢复计划,以防止数据丢失和系统故障。

    4. 数据库维护和故障排除:数据库程序员负责监控数据库系统的运行状态,及时发现和解决数据库故障和错误。他们执行数据库维护任务,如数据清理、索引重建和数据库重组等,以确保数据库的稳定性和可靠性。

    5. 数据库性能分析和优化:数据库程序员使用性能分析工具和技术来评估数据库系统的性能,并提出改进建议。他们分析数据库查询的执行计划,识别慢查询和瓶颈,优化查询语句和索引设计,以提高系统的响应速度和吞吐量。

    总之,数据库程序员在设计、开发和管理数据库系统方面发挥着关键作用,确保数据的安全性、完整性和可靠性,并优化数据库性能以满足业务需求。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库程序员通常被称为数据库开发工程师或数据库管理员。他们负责设计、创建和维护数据库系统,确保数据的安全性、完整性和可靠性。数据库程序员需要具备良好的编程技能和数据库知识,能够使用SQL语言操作数据库,并能够优化数据库性能和解决数据相关问题。他们还需要了解不同的数据库管理系统(如MySQL、Oracle、SQL Server等)以及相关的技术和工具。数据库程序员在软件开发团队中扮演着重要的角色,帮助开发人员和系统管理员处理和管理数据。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库程序员通常被称为数据库开发工程师或数据库管理员。他们负责设计、开发和管理数据库系统,确保数据的安全性、完整性和高效性。数据库程序员需要具备良好的数据库管理和开发技能,熟悉数据库管理系统和编程语言。

    以下是数据库程序员的一般工作流程和操作方法:

    1. 需求分析和设计:

      • 与业务团队沟通,了解数据库需求和业务规则;
      • 根据需求设计数据库结构,包括表、字段、关系等。
    2. 数据库建模:

      • 使用数据库建模工具(如ERWin、PowerDesigner等)创建数据库模型;
      • 根据需求和设计规范创建表、字段、主键、外键等;
      • 设计数据库索引和约束,以提高查询性能和数据完整性。
    3. 数据库编程:

      • 使用SQL语言进行数据库编程;
      • 编写DDL语句创建表、视图、存储过程、触发器等;
      • 编写DML语句进行数据的插入、更新和删除;
      • 编写查询语句进行数据的查询和报表生成。
    4. 数据库优化:

      • 分析和优化查询语句,提高查询性能;
      • 设计合适的索引,加速数据检索;
      • 优化数据库参数设置,提高数据库性能;
      • 监控数据库性能,及时调整和优化。
    5. 数据库备份和恢复:

      • 定期备份数据库,保证数据的安全性;
      • 编写恢复脚本,以便在数据丢失或故障时恢复数据库;
      • 进行灾备和容灾规划,确保数据库的高可用性。
    6. 数据库安全:

      • 设计和实施数据库访问控制策略,保护数据的安全性;
      • 监控和审计数据库访问,及时发现和阻止潜在的安全威胁;
      • 定期更新和升级数据库软件,修复安全漏洞。
    7. 故障排除和问题解决:

      • 分析和解决数据库故障和性能问题;
      • 监控数据库运行状态,及时发现和处理异常情况;
      • 根据错误日志和性能监控数据,定位和修复问题。

    总结:数据库程序员是负责设计、开发和管理数据库系统的专业人员。他们需要具备良好的数据库管理和编程技能,以及良好的问题解决能力。在工作中,他们需要进行需求分析和设计、数据库建模、数据库编程、数据库优化、数据库备份和恢复、数据库安全等工作,以确保数据库的安全、完整和高效运行。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部